What is an E-Cigarette?

An e-cigarette is a battery-powered device that allows users to inhale aerosol, commonly referred to as vapor, rather than smoke. It simulates the feeling of smoking but without burning tobacco. The core components of an e-cigarette include the battery, an atomizer, and a e-liquid cartridge.

Users can choose from a variety of flavors and nicotine levels, which is one of the attractive features of e-cigarettes.

How E-Cigarettes Work

The operation of e-cigarettes is fairly straightforward. When the user activates the device, the battery powers the atomizer. This atomizer is equipped with a coil that heats the e-liquid, turning it into vapor, which the user then inhales. The inhalation mimics the experience of smoking, delivering nicotine and flavor without the tar and harmful chemicals typically found in tobacco smoke.

Common Misconceptions

Despite their benefits, some misconceptions about e-cigarettes persist. A prevailing myth is that e-cigarettes are entirely safe; however, while they are generally considered less harmful than traditional cigarettes, they are not devoid of risks.

Another common assumption is that e-cigarettes are an effective smoking cessation tool. While they can assist some smokers in reducing or quitting tobacco, they are not officially recognized as cessation devices by many health organizations.
